The annual SPUSD Tiger Run took place on Saturday, Dec. 2 from 8 a.m. to 10:30 a.m. The South Pasadena High School Booster Club hosted the event with the support of the Aztlan Athletics Foundation. The event aims to provide financial funding for athletic and extracurricular programs at the high school. Over 800 runners registered, which surpasses previous years’ participation numbers.
